Evaluation and Enhancement of the AFIT Autonomous Face Recognition Machine.

Abstract

This thesis evaluates and improves the Autonomous Face Recognition Machine (AFRM) created in 1985 at AFIT. This effort involved re-writing the AFRM code in the C programming Language and hosting it on a Mirco-VAX II. In addition, several new algorithms were added to the AFRM including: brightness normalization of input images, moving target detection, and a new face location algorithm. The results of this effort include: improved face location, higher recognition accuracy, and near real-time processing. This thesis includes a complete description of the AFRM and its development history. Keywords: Computers, Image processing, Artificial, Image segmentation.
